Volkswagen Boosts Stake in MAN

[Stay on top of transportation news: Get TTNews in your inbox.]

German truck maker MAN SE said Volkswagen AG has boosted its majority stake in the company to 73% of its common shares, Reuters reported Friday.

Volkswagen, which purchased a majority stake in MAN in November, previously held 55.9% of the voting rights.

Volkswagen is seeking to merge its commercial vehicle operations with MAN and truck manufacturer Scania AB of Sweden, which Volkswagen also controls.
